About

Shengdong Cheng is a scholar working on Soil Science, Water Science and Technology and Environmental Engineering. According to data from OpenAlex, Shengdong Cheng has authored 40 papers receiving a total of 796 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Soil Science, 17 papers in Water Science and Technology and 9 papers in Environmental Engineering. Recurrent topics in Shengdong Cheng's work include Soil erosion and sediment transport (24 papers), Hydrology and Watershed Management Studies (13 papers) and Soil Carbon and Nitrogen Dynamics (7 papers). Shengdong Cheng is often cited by papers focused on Soil erosion and sediment transport (24 papers), Hydrology and Watershed Management Studies (13 papers) and Soil Carbon and Nitrogen Dynamics (7 papers). Shengdong Cheng collaborates with scholars based in China, Germany and Singapore. Shengdong Cheng's co-authors include Peng Li, Guoce Xu, Zhanbin Li, Yuting Cheng, Zhanbin Li, Zongping Ren, Tian Wang, Haidong Gao, Feichao Wang and Xiukang Wang and has published in prestigious journals such as The Science of The Total Environment, Scientific Reports and Geoderma.
